Until filled. The Occupational Therapist (OT) is an integral member of the Occupational Therapy service, Allied Health and clinical programs in which care is provided. Through assessment, treatment, evaluation and consultation, the OT prevents, alleviates or minimizes dysfunction, enabling clients to achieve their maximum level of functional independence and facilitating their integration into the home, community and workplace. As a crucial member of the Geriatrics, MSK, and Multisystem Rehab team, the OT: Provides comprehensive assessment, intervention, consultation and education services for geriatric patients and patients with musculoskeletal and other multi-system conditions; Makes appropriate referrals; Develops and maintains community resource networks; Performs department responsibilities to contribute to the efficient and effective provision of service; Collaborates with inter-professional team in providing patient focused care; Provides training and supervision of Occupational Therapy students; is involved in quality management and research initiatives; Participates in professional, program and hospital development, as appropriate; performs other duties consistent with the job classification as required. Qualifications

Completion of Bachelors Degree or equivalent in Occupational Therapy Current registration with the College of Occupational Therapists of Ontario (COTO) Basic Cardiac Life Support (B Level or C Level) Heart Saver Plus Canada Membership with Professional Association (e.g. CAOT, OSOT) is preferred Experience in musculoskeletal and orthopaedic conditions required Experience in geriatrics preferred ADP Authorizer is an asset Demonstrated ability to use theoretical and evidence-based concepts, and research findings in practice Strong clinical skills related to patient goal setting and creative treatment interventions Demonstrated ability to identify and meet own learning needs in pursuit of ongoing professional development Demonstrated leadership in quality improvement initiatives to enhance patient care Demonstrated competence with departmental and hospital safety, emergency and infection control procedures Ability to exercise sound clinical judgment and to function in an independent, self-directed manner Excellent written, oral and nonverbal communication and interpersonal skills Computer proficiency
